Output 945126801340ad3888cc4a443e8b5e6450e1111de8188c9d2e9f0248f2351d61:2

value
688785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 490b3ee86f89861b33411054e066647433b211ee OP_EQUAL
address
38MEiv1FVaiW8GmrLhafKYHoFVhTyVyqjS
transaction
945126801340ad3888cc4a443e8b5e6450e1111de8188c9d2e9f0248f2351d61
spent
true